What Is a Bail Bond?

A bail bond is an economic contract that enables a detained individual to be released from safekeeping while waiting for test. This plan involves a 3rd party, typically a Bail bondsman, that guarantees the court that the person will certainly return for their arranged court appearances. In exchange for this solution, the bondsman normally charges a non-refundable cost, usually a percent of the overall Bail amount.

Bail bonds offer an important function in the lawful system, providing a system for accuseds to keep their flexibility throughout the pre-trial stage. This can aid them prepare for their defense better. The Bail quantity is figured out by the court based on numerous elements, including the extent of the offense, the offender's criminal background, and the danger of trip. Eventually, a bail bond represents a commitment to maintain lawful responsibilities while allowing individuals the possibility to proceed their lives until their court date.

Just How Bail Bonds Job

Bail bonds run via an uncomplicated procedure that includes several vital steps. Initially, an offender or their depictive get in touches with a bail bond agent after an arrest. The representative assesses the scenario, including the Bail quantity established by the defendant and the court's history. As soon as a decision is made, the representative typically calls for a non-refundable charge, generally a percentage of the complete Bail quantity, typically varying from 10% to 15%.

After the fee is paid, the agent safeguards the Bail by signing a contract with the court, making sure that the offender appears for all scheduled court dates. If the offender falls short to appear, the bail bond representative is in charge of the full Bail amount, leading the representative to seek out the accused. Throughout this process, the bail bond agent plays a crucial function in promoting the release of the accused while taking care of the associated economic risks.

Kinds Of Bail Bonds

Understanding the various sorts of Bail bonds is important for accuseds and their families as they navigate the legal system. There are numerous usual types of Bail bonds readily available, each offering a details objective.

One of the most widespread is the guaranty bond, which involves a Bail bondsman assuring the full Bail amount in exchange for a charge. One more kind is the cash bond, where the defendant or their household pays the full Bail amount in cash money straight to the court.

Property bonds permit individuals to make use of realty as security for the Bail amount. Furthermore, government bonds are details to federal situations, typically needing a greater costs and a lot more rigid conditions.

Ultimately, immigration bonds are used in situations concerning migration offenses. Each kind of bond has unique procedures and effects, making it crucial for those entailed to comprehend their options extensively.


The Costs Entailed in Protecting a Bail Bond



Safeguarding a bail bond requires various prices that can greatly influence a defendant's financial resources. The major expense is the premium, generally ranging from 10% to 15% of the complete Bail quantity set by the court. This costs is non-refundable, no matter the situation result, representing the bail bond representative's fee for their solutions. Extra prices might consist of administrative fees, which some agents impose for processing documentation, and collateral demands, where the defendant might require to provide assets to safeguard the bond. Responsibilities of the Indemnitor

Steering via the intricacies of Bail bonds needs a clear understanding of the duties of the indemnitor. The indemnitor, often a relative or buddy of the accused, plays a significant role in the Bail process. This private consents to think financial responsibility, making sure that the Bail amount is paid if the accused falls short to show up in court. It is necessary for the indemnitor to preserve interaction with the bail bond representative throughout the process, supplying any needed info and updates pertaining to the accused's scenario.

Furthermore, the indemnitor should safeguard collateral, which might consist of home or belongings, to back the bail bond. Typical Misconceptions Regarding Bail Bonds

Several individuals nurture misunderstandings regarding Bail bonds, which can complicate their understanding of the Bail procedure. One widespread misconception is that Bail bonds are a kind of repayment that guarantees an accused's launch. In truth, they are an assurance to the court that the offender will stand for their arranged hearings. Another common idea is that only wealthy people can pay for Bail. Nevertheless, bondsman normally charge a portion of the total Bail quantity, making it available to a broader variety of individuals. In addition, some people think that Bail is refundable. While the premium paid to the Bail bondsman is not refundable, the Bail quantity itself might be returned upon the conclusion of the situation, supplied the accused fulfills all court needs. Resolving these misconceptions is necessary for people passing through the complexities of the Bail system and guaranteeing they make educated choices.
